


资源介绍
Astro入门实战 (中文字幕英文视频教程)
本课程《Astro入门实战 (中文字幕英文视频教程)》(原课程名:Getting started with Astro (Managed Apache Airflow))是一套针对Astro(托管式Apache Airflow)的入门级实战教程,专为想要掌握Astro工具应用、Apache Airflow工作流构建与部署的学习者打造。课程整体采用英文视频搭配中文SRT字幕的形式,确保不同英语水平的学习者都能精准理解知识点,全程聚焦实战操作,从基础认知到进阶应用层层递进,帮助学习者快速上手并能独立完成Astro相关项目的开发与部署。
整套课程共包含26个视频文件(均为MP4格式),按学习逻辑划分为五大模块,每个模块围绕核心知识点设置专属教学内容,配套对应的中文字幕,实现理论讲解与实操演示的深度结合,覆盖Astro学习全流程,无论是零基础的新手,还是有一定Apache Airflow基础、想要转向Astro工具的开发者,都能从中获得系统的知识与实用的技能。
课程开篇为“课程导言”模块,包含3个视频,作为整个课程的入门引导。该模块首先明确课程目标,让学习者清晰知晓通过本课程能够掌握的核心能力与学习方向;随后讲解课程先修要求,帮助学习者判断自身基础是否适配,提前做好学习准备;最后通过“讲师介绍”环节,建立学习者与讲师之间的信任链接,让学习者了解授课团队的专业背景,增强学习信心。此模块为后续学习奠定基础,帮助学习者快速进入学习状态。
第二模块为“Astro基础认知”,包含6个视频,聚焦Astro的核心概念与入门操作。课程首先解答“为什么选择Astro”这一核心问题,从工具优势、应用场景等维度解析Astro的价值,帮助学习者建立对工具的初步认知;接着深入讲解“Astro是什么”,明确其作为托管式Apache Airflow的核心定位、功能特性及适用场景;随后拆解Astro的关键概念,扫清理论障碍,为实操环节做好铺垫。在理论讲解之后,课程立即进入实战环节,演示如何快速上手Astro、创建第一个部署项目,同时分享节省资源用量的实用技巧,让学习者在掌握基础操作的同时,培养高效使用工具的意识,实现理论与实操的即时衔接。
第三模块为“DAG构建实战”,是整套课程的核心模块,包含10个视频,全面覆盖DAG(有向无环图)构建的全流程与关键技术。模块开篇从Astro CLI工具入手,讲解其功能定位、使用方法,为本地开发环境搭建提供支撑;随后指导学习者搭建Airflow本地开发环境,这是后续所有实操的基础,课程通过详细步骤演示,确保学习者能够顺利完成环境配置,避免因环境问题影响学习进度。在此基础上,课程逐步深入DAG构建核心,讲解变量与连接的相关知识及最佳管理方式,帮助学习者掌握工作流配置的核心技巧;演示全新的DAG构建方法,结合本地项目导入实操,让学习者掌握将本地项目迁移至Astro的关键步骤。
同时,该模块专门设置Astro配置相关内容,指导学习者如何配置Astro以实现DAG和任务的测试,并分享最简单高效的测试方法,帮助学习者规避项目上线后的潜在问题,培养严谨的开发习惯。此外,模块还包含AI辅助编码的实操内容,演示如何借助内置AI工具提升编码效率与准确性,助力学习者掌握智能化开发技巧,提升工作效率。整个模块实操性极强,每个知识点都搭配对应的案例演示,让学习者能够跟着操作、快速掌握。
第四模块为“DAG部署方法”,包含6个视频,聚焦Astro中DAG的多种部署方式及实操要点。课程首先对不同部署方法进行整体概述,对比各类方法的适用场景、优势与不足,帮助学习者根据实际项目需求选择合适的部署方案;随后分别详细演示常见部署方式、最快部署方式、特殊部署方式以及可扩展的生产环境部署方式,每种方式都通过 step-by-step 实操讲解,确保学习者能够独立完成部署操作。同时,课程特别提醒学习者不要忘记休眠部署项目,分享资源优化与管理的实用技巧,帮助学习者在实际应用中降低资源消耗,控制成本,兼顾实用性与经济性。
第五模块为“Astro进阶应用”,包含3个视频,旨在帮助学习者突破基础应用瓶颈,掌握Astro的进阶技能。模块首先讲解如何了解Airflow指标,指导学习者通过指标监控掌握项目运行状态,及时发现运行中的异常情况;随后介绍告警机制的配置方法,让学习者能够在项目出现问题时及时收到提醒,快速响应并解决问题,保障工作流的稳定运行;最后以“后续学习方向”收尾,为学习者提供进阶学习建议,帮助学习者在课程结束后能够持续提升,将Astro技能应用到更复杂的实际项目中。
整套课程始终秉持“实战为王”的理念,每个知识点都结合具体操作案例讲解,避免纯理论的枯燥灌输,让学习者在动手实践中理解知识、掌握技能。中文SRT字幕的配置的确保了学习者能够精准捕捉视频中的关键信息,即使是英文基础薄弱的学习者也能轻松跟上课程节奏。课程覆盖Astro从入门到进阶的全流程知识,从基础认知、环境搭建、DAG构建、项目部署到进阶监控告警,形成完整的知识体系,帮助学习者快速具备Astro工具的独立应用能力,为后续从事工作流管理、数据自动化相关工作奠定坚实基础。无论是职场人士想要提升技能、拓展职业边界,还是学生想要提前学习实用技术、增强就业竞争力,本课程都是一套高效、优质的学习资源。